Today, we drove an hour through Lisbon to the North to a place called Palace de Monserrate. We had to investigate just because of the name. We owned a house in the Caribbean on an island called Monserrat. We have visited a monestary called Monserrat in Northern Spain and now the Palace de Monserrate in Portugal. The drive into Monserrate: Very narrow road Now those pics were of walk to the castle. These are of the castle: Of course, the library The Palace was first built in the 1700's as the summer resort of the Portuguese court. An earthquake completely destroyed it and was it rebuilt in 1858 for Sir Frances Cook and his family.
